Makeup Styles of the 80s for Women: 10 Iconic Looks

The 1980s was a decade known for its vibrant and diverse cultural landscape and this diversity was nowhere more apparent than in the world of fashion and beauty. Women in the ’80s embraced a wide range of makeup styles each reflecting the era’s unique blend of rebellion extravagance and artistic expression.

1. Punk Princess

80s makeup Punk Princess

  • Introduction: The ‘Punk Princess’ makeup style of the 80s was a rebellious and bold expression of individuality with vibrant eyeshadows heavy eyeliner and daring lip colors.
  • Detailed Article: This makeup style was heavily influenced by punk music and fashion and it represented the non-conformist spirit of the era. Women who embraced this style often used dark moody eyeshadows in shades like black deep purple or electric blue. Eyeliner was thick extending beyond the corner of the eyes and lips were adorned with unconventional colors like deep black or fiery red.

2. Neon Lights

80s makeup Neon Lights

  • Introduction: The ‘Neon Lights’ makeup style from the 80s was all about embracing the vibrant eye-catching colors of neon with bright blues pinks and greens dominating the eyeshadow palettes.
  • Detailed Article: This style was a bold departure from traditional makeup using neon shades to create a striking look. The eyes were the focal point with dazzling neon eyeshadows applied generously often extending out to dramatic winged shapes. Lips were typically kept understated with a sheer glossy finish letting the eyes steal the show.

4. New Wave

80s Makeup New Wave

  • Introduction: The ‘New Wave’ makeup style of the 80s was a rebellious and avant-garde approach to beauty characterized by bold geometric shapes and vibrant colors.
  • Detailed Article: The New Wave movement was not just about music and fashion; it also had a profound influence on makeup. This unique style embraced bold unconventional shapes and vibrant hues. Eyes were adorned with sharp angular lines and striking geometric designs. Bright daring colors such as electric blue neon pink and vivid green were used liberally to create a mesmerizing effect. This makeup style allowed individuals to make a bold and artistic statement.
  • Key Elements:
    • Angular and geometric eyeshadow designs.
    • Use of bright and unconventional colors.
    • Strong eyeliner and well-defined brows.
    • A departure from traditional makeup norms to embrace an artistic and rebellious expression of self.

This ‘New Wave’ makeup style encapsulated the artistic and unconventional spirit of the 80s providing a platform for self-expression through bold and daring makeup choices.

5. Glam Rock

80s Makeup Glam Rock

  • Introduction: The ‘Glam Rock’ makeup style of the 80s was a dazzling and extravagant expression of individuality heavily influenced by the rock music scene. It featured heavy eyeliner shimmery eyeshadows and deep red lips creating a look that screamed rockstar glamour.
  • Detailed Article: Glam Rock was all about opulence and self-indulgence. This makeup style was heavily influenced by iconic rockstars like David Bowie Marc Bolan and Freddie Mercury. Eyes were defined by intense eyeliner sometimes extended into dramatic cat-eye shapes and adorned with shimmery eyeshadows often in metallic or glittery hues. Lips took center stage with deep bold shades of red oxblood or plum. This look was a perfect representation of the over-the-top androgynous fashion and makeup trends that defined the era.
  • Key Elements:
    • Heavy eyeliner and bold cat-eye shapes.
    • Shimmery and metallic eyeshadows.
    • Dark and striking lip colors.
    • Androgynous and extravagant fashion choices.

Glam Rock makeup captured the essence of rockstar glamour allowing individuals to embrace their inner rockstar and make a bold flamboyant statement. It was a fusion of music fashion and makeup celebrating the audacious spirit of the 80s.

7. Electric Blue

80s Makeup Electric Blue

  • Introduction: The ‘Electric Blue’ makeup style of the 80s celebrated the bold and vibrant use of blue eyeshadows creating a striking and memorable look.
  • Detailed Article: Electric Blue was a trend that embraced the captivating allure of the color blue. It involved the generous use of bright electric blue eyeshadow often paired with contrasting eyeliner in shades of black or deep blue. This style was all about creating a dramatic and captivating gaze. Lips were typically left in more neutral tones to let the eyes shine. Electric Blue was a trend that could be both daring and mesmerizing and it remains an iconic representation of 80s makeup.
  • Key Elements:
    • Vibrant electric blue eyeshadows.
    • Bold and contrasting eyeliners.
    • Neutral lip colors to emphasize the eyes.
    • A captivating and dramatic gaze.

The ‘Electric Blue’ makeup style was an embodiment of the bold and experimental makeup trends of the 80s allowing individuals to make a powerful and memorable statement.

8. Cyberpunk

80s Makeup Cyberpunk

  • Introduction: The ‘Cyberpunk’ makeup style of the 80s was influenced by science fiction and embraced metallic shades creating a futuristic and edgy look.
  • Detailed Article: Cyberpunk makeup was an extension of the growing fascination with technology and the future in the 80s. It featured metallic eyeshadows eyeliners and lip colors often with holographic or iridescent effects. This style wasn’t just about makeup; it often included metallic tattoos and body art. The look was daring futuristic and celebrated the idea of merging humanity with machines.
  • Key Elements:
    • Metallic eyeshadows eyeliners and lip colors.
    • Holographic and iridescent effects.
    • Metallic tattoos and body art.
    • A futuristic and edgy appearance.

The ‘Cyberpunk’ makeup style embodied the futuristic and avant-garde spirit of the 80s allowing individuals to explore the boundaries between humanity and technology.

9. Miami Vice Vibe

80s Makeup Miami Vice Vibe

  • Introduction: The ‘Miami Vice Vibe’ makeup style of the 80s was a celebration of sun-soaked beaches featuring pastel tones bronzed skin and a relaxed beachy look.
  • Detailed Article: Miami Vice Vibe was all about capturing the essence of a beach vacation in your makeup. Pastel eyeshadows and lip colors often in shades of coral peach or baby blue were prevalent. Skin was bronzed and highlighted to create a sun-kissed glow. This makeup style was accompanied by relaxed and beachy fashion choices perfectly embodying the spirit of a carefree vacation.
  • Key Elements:
    • Pastel eyeshadows and lip colors.
    • Bronzed and highlighted skin.
    • A sun-kissed beachy appearance.
    • Relaxed and casual fashion choices.

The ‘Miami Vice Vibe’ makeup style offered a refreshing and laid-back alternative to the more extravagant trends of the 80s allowing individuals to embrace the feeling of a perpetual beach vacation.
